The scattering of the Jewish people to many lands
DanielleElmas [232]
Are you looking for a word to name it?

A name used for the scattered Jewish population is the Jewish diaspora.

The word "diaspora", which in the meantime can be used to any scattered population, actually originally refereed to the Jewish diaspora. It comes from Greek and it was used in the Greek translation of the Old Testament.

Sally is the manager of Grubb It, a fast-food outlet. She is looking out for trends or events that could turn out to be a proble
kicyunya [14]

Answer:

This question is incomplete. Here are the missing options:

  • <u>a. environmental scanning</u>
  • b. stakeholder mapping
  • c. contingency planning
  • d. a strategic review process

The answer is a. environmental scanning.

Explanation:

Environmental scanning consists in observing an organisation's internal and external environment. This is done in order to improve the current and future state of a company.

In the example, Sally is concerned with the external environment. Some of the factors to examine are recent events, competition and the physical environment.
